William "Bill" E. Groom, age 85 passed away on Friday September 13, 2013. He was born on July 20, 1928 in Steuben Wisconsin.  The son of Enoch and Maude (Lomas) Groom. He married Ruth Waller, and later  married Gloria Tamayo in May  of 1986 in Prairie du Chien Wisconsin. Bill was Navy veteran,  and after his discharge he enlisted into the Army reserve's from 1952 to 1955.  Bill retired from Oscar Mayer as a mechanic and union steward.  He enjoyed deer hunting and wood working. He was always mechanically inclined and liked to fix,build, and create unique things.  He is best known by family and friends as a great storyteller. He was not always right,but never wrong.  He is survived by his wife Gloria Groom of Moline Illinois. 1 daughter Connie Gregg of Davenport IA. 3 sons Richard Groom of Davenport IAA., Rick (Barb) Groom of Prairie du Chien, Mick (Kathy) Groom of Hutchinson Ks. 14 Grandchildren 27 Great-Grandchildren. 1 Brother Richard (Donna) Groom of Davenport IAA. 2 sister in laws: Madonna Groom of Steuben, Marilyn Groom of Boscobel. He is also survived by his beloved bird "Elijah". He was preceded in death by his parents, 5 brothers Claire, Jack, Donald, Harry, Tom Groom. 2 sisters Cleo Martin, Marie Daugherty. 1 grandson Joshua Groom.
Funeral Services will be held on Thursday September 19, 2013 at 11:00 A.M. at the Kendall Funeral Home in Boscobel. Pastor Chuck Miller officiating. Burial in the Gays Mills Cemetery. Friends may call on Wednesday from 4:00-7:00 P.M.at Kendall Funeral Home in Boscobel, with a Masonic Service at 7:00 P.M.Military honors will be accorded by the Daugherty-Larson American Legion Post # 443 of Steuben.
